17. Indeed, the believers 'Muslims'6, Jews7, Sabeans, Nazarenes 'i.e., Christians'8, Zoroastrians, and the polytheists - Allāh will judge between them on the Day of Resurrection. Surely Allāh is a Witness over all things.
6. Muslims believe in one God 'Allāh', who is not and has never been human. The idea of the Trinity of the Christians is just weird to a Muslim. So is the idea of original sin and salvation. These are completely rejected by Islam. In Islam, to be saved from the Hellfire you ou are supposed to believe in one God, Allāh ' and His messengers, and to live your life with righteousness and charity.
7. Islamic theology rejects the notion believed by the Jews such as Lot being sinful and disobeying God, David being adulterer as they claim. Also, Islamic faith holds that the Torah that Jews possess now is an altered version of a lost original copy. Also, Jews do not accept Jesus and Muhammad as prophets, while the Muslims believe in Allāh, His angels, His Scriptures, His messengers, the Last Day and the predestination.
8. Today's Christianity doesn’t believe in the Oneness of God and does not believe in His last messenger, the prophet Muhammad. Denying one messenger of God is just as denying all. Also, Christianity doesn’t include the laws of Islam which include: spiritual, mental, and physical behavior such as rituals: daily prayers, fasting, almsgiving, and pilgrimage.
Prohibitions: Gambling, alcohol consumption, and the giving and receiving of interest (usury) that are prohibited in Islam and the dietary laws and other injunctions related to everyday behavior. Muslims submit only to God and His laws.

API specs
Endpoints:
Sura translation
GET / https://quranenc.com/api/v1/translation/sura/{translation_key}/{sura_number} description: get the specified translation (by its translation_key) for the speicified sura (by its number)
Parameters: translation_key: (the key of the currently selected translation) sura_number: [1-114] (Sura number in the mosshaf which should be between 1 and 114)
Returns:
json object containing array of objects, each object contains the "sura", "aya", "translation" and "footnotes".
GET / https://quranenc.com/api/v1/translation/aya/{translation_key}/{sura_number}/{aya_number} description: get the specified translation (by its translation_key) for the speicified aya (by its number sura_number and aya_number)
Parameters: translation_key: (the key of the currently selected translation) sura_number: [1-114] (Sura number in the mosshaf which should be between 1 and 114) aya_number: [1-...] (Aya number in the sura)
Returns:
json object containing the "sura", "aya", "translation" and "footnotes".
